Objects That Do Table Lookups
It is quite common in database application design to present the user with a list of choices. Occasionally, a list is static and hard coded, but often the list is table driven. Sometimes, a list needs to change dynamically, depending on the value of another form object, selection text, or variable. Often the developer will make the list selections more user friendly by presenting an "alias" for an encoded field. This document explores how to develop these types of lists in Alpha Anywhere.
Creating Conditional Table Lookups
When one of several tables might supply the field's value, use a Conditional table lookup. Instead of choosing one lookup table, you complete the Table Conditions table, filling in the names of two or more tables along with a Conditional expression for each that determines which table is used for the lookup. The tables you use must have the same field names and types since there is only one field mapping.
Image Capture for List-Detail View - Camera/Photo Library
This action is used exclusively for image fields in a List Detail View. Capture an image using the camera, or from the photo library. On devices that don't support a camera, select an image from the filesystem.
Dynamic List Table Lookups
Many applications call for the contents of list boxes to dynamically changeĀ asĀ variables (external to the list box) change.
Fires after the user has selected a row in a List and the List's Detail View has been populated.
Fires after the Detail View for a record is shown.
Below detail view part
You can enter any HTML to appear below the detail view part of the component.
Optional. Default = "center".The vertical position of the window. Possible values are:
The .WINDOW_POSITION() method positions a browse on the screen.
Fires after the Detail View has been rendered.